Compartir tecnología

Procesamiento del lenguaje natural con Python

2024-07-12

한어Русский языкEnglishFrançaisIndonesianSanskrit日本語DeutschPortuguêsΕλληνικάespañolItalianoSuomalainenLatina

Hola a todos, soy Muzuo!
El procesamiento del lenguaje natural (PNL) es una rama importante del campo de la inteligencia artificial que se compromete a permitir que las computadoras comprendan, analicen y generen el lenguaje humano. Con el desarrollo de big data y el aprendizaje profundo, la PNL se ha utilizado ampliamente en diversos campos, como la traducción automática, el análisis de sentimientos, el resumen de textos, etc. Este artículo presentará cómo usar Python para el procesamiento del lenguaje natural, incluidas las bibliotecas y herramientas de uso común, así como algunos casos prácticos.

Biblioteca de PNL en Python

Python proporciona una rica biblioteca de PNL que puede ayudar a implementar rápidamente varias tareas de PNL. A continuación se muestran algunas bibliotecas de PNL de uso común:

No se puede leer

NLTK (Natural Language Toolkit) es una biblioteca Python de código abierto para procesar datos del lenguaje humano. Proporciona muchas funciones, como segmentación de palabras, etiquetado de partes del discurso, reconocimiento de entidades con nombre, etc. El comando para instalar NLTK es el siguiente:

!pip install nltk
  • 1
espacio

spaCy es una poderosa biblioteca de Python para procesar y comprender el lenguaje humano. Proporciona muchas funciones, como segmentación de palabras, etiquetado de partes del discurso, resolución de dependencias, etc. El comando para instalar spaCy es el siguiente:

!pip install spacy
  • 1
Gensim

Gensim es una biblioteca de Python para procesar datos de texto, que se utiliza principalmente para algoritmos de aprendizaje no supervisados, como modelos de temas, similitud de documentos, etc.El comando para instalar Gensim es el siguiente